Virginia J. Robb 96, of San Angelo went to be with her Lord and Savior on Tuesday October 2, 2018 in San Angelo. Virginia was born August 1, 1922 in Conroe, Texas to Hugh and Dezzie (Brock) Wall. The oldest of five children, Virginia grew up in Lufkin, Texas and graduated from Lufkin High School. After High School she married a wonderful man, Roy E. Robb on February 22, 1940. They settled in Houston, Texas where they made their home and raised two boys, Roy and Ron. Virginia was a loving wife, mother, friend, and caring Mother who enjoyed being a homemaker for her family. Virginia went to work for Wide Lite when her sons were in junior high school and spent almost 20 years with the company. After Roy E. retired and Virginia retired they moved to Lake Buchannan, where they spent all their retirement years. Virginia loved the outdoors and was an avid fisherwoman when the white bass were running, she also loved shopping. In her younger years, she loved playing tennis, skating, extended bike rides and basically just being outdoors. Flowers were very important in her life and she loved gardening and growing flowers in her yard. She was very active in her church in Kingsland, Texas as well as any other Bible study in her area. The Order of the Eastern Star was very important and she served as Worthy Matron of several chapters across Texas. Virginia also served as District Deputy Grand Matron for an area of Texas for two years. Her life and legacy of love and faith in the Lord will live on in our hearts forever and we will dearly miss her! Virginia was preceded in death by her parents, her husband Roy E., 2 brothers and 2 sisters. She is survived by sons who adored her, Roy K. Robb and his wife Kay, of San Angelo and Ronald G. Robb and his wife Sylvia, of Georgetown, Texas: her 4 grandchildren, John Robb and his wife Patricia of Denver, Colorado, and Amy Robb of Dayton, Ohio, James Robb and his wife Brandy of Austin, Texas and Joel Robb and his wife Gillian of Austin, Texas.
